Understanding the Product: Key Specifications
Before making a purchase, it’s important to be aware of the critical quality parameters for (R)-Boc-3-Amino-3-(2-bromophenyl)propionic Acid. The most vital specifications include:
- Purity: Typically, a minimum purity of ≥98% by High-Performance Liquid Chromatography (HPLC) is expected. This ensures that side reactions are minimized and the final product is reliable.
- Chiral Purity: As a chiral compound, its enantiomeric purity is crucial. While not always explicitly stated as a separate specification in basic listings, it's a key factor for biological applications. Researchers may inquire about optical rotation data or request specific analytical methods to confirm enantiomeric excess (ee).
- Appearance: The standard appearance is a white to off-white solid or powder. Significant deviations might indicate contamination or degradation.
- CAS Number: The correct CAS number, 500789-07-1, is essential for accurate identification and ordering.
Identifying Reliable Suppliers and Manufacturers
Finding a dependable source is critical for ensuring the quality and consistency of your chemical supplies. When looking to buy (R)-Boc-3-Amino-3-(2-bromophenyl)propionic Acid, consider the following types of suppliers:
- Specialty Chemical Manufacturers: Companies that focus on producing chiral intermediates, amino acid derivatives, and building blocks for the pharmaceutical industry are often the most reliable. They usually have robust quality control systems and can provide detailed analytical documentation.
- Chemical Distributors: Reputable distributors can offer access to a wide range of products from various manufacturers. However, it's always advisable to verify the distributor's sourcing and quality assurance practices.
- Custom Synthesis Providers: If specific grades or quantities not readily available are needed, custom synthesis services can be an option. These providers can often tailor production to meet exact specifications.
The Purchase Process: What to Expect
When you are ready to purchase, expect to provide details about your required quantity, desired purity, and delivery timeline. Most suppliers will offer pricing based on quantity, with discounts available for bulk orders. Requesting a formal quotation is a standard practice, especially for larger amounts. Ensure that the supplier can provide essential documentation such as a Certificate of Analysis (CoA) with each batch and a Safety Data Sheet (SDS) for safe handling and storage. For international procurement, understanding shipping costs, import regulations, and lead times is also important.
